CHRISTCHURCH FACTORY FIRE
DAMAGE ESTIMATED AT OVER £2OOO Christchurch, This Day. Damage assessed at more than £2OOO f! one by aa outbreak of fire about 1.40 this morning at the Pro-Vita Mills where cereal products are made. The lire broke out in the drying rooms, occupying the central portion of the buildings. Although firemen suffered from the effects of fumes from protein pro- ! ducts in the burning and drying rooms i they were able to confine the outbreak 1 to the central block.—P.A
